designed to invest in your long-term success. The Field Technician
(L2) executes installation services as defined under applicable
agreements and performs work to required technical, quality, and
safety standards. This role is capable of independently performing
installation services with little to no guidance from lead
technicians and operates effectively in live, mission-critical data
center environments. The Field Technician (L2) also supports
quality assurance and quality control processes and provides
mentorship to entry-level technicians. Fieldwork may include
overtime, weekends, holidays, and off-hours. Travel may be required
based on business needs. Job Duties and Responsibilities Execute
installation services as defined under contractual agreements
Perform installation work to required technical, safety, QA, and QC
standards Perform all installation services required for the role
without supervision Establish scope, work plans, and procedures
with minimal guidance from lead technicians Identify, troubleshoot,
and restore complex, multi-domain failures across fiber optic and
twisted pair systems, including loss of signal, low signal, and
interface errors Identify and resolve issues independently without
escalation Support QA and QC requirements for assigned work Work
effectively in live, operational, mission-critical environments
Train and mentor L1 Field Trainee Technicians Technical Knowledge,
Skills, and Abilities Advanced troubleshooting skills across fiber
optic and copper systems Familiarity with PON or
point-to-multipoint network deployments utilizing simplex fiber and
non-standard wavelengths Proficiency in fiber optic testing using
OTDR and OLTS Certified in fiber splicing Strong understanding of
structured cabling systems, testing methodologies, and
documentation requirements Ability to operate independently while
maintaining quality, safety, and customer standards Education and
Experience 3 or more years of documented industry experience
Documented fiber optic testing certification on OTDR and OLTS Fiber
splicing certification required Experience performing work in
operational environments and on projects within live
mission-critical data centers Possession of all relevant
certifications required for the role High School diploma or GED
required Valid driver’s license with a satisfactory driving record
Physical Requirements Ability to sit, climb, balance, stoop, kneel,
crouch, and crawl Ability to lift up to 75 pounds Ability to work
